Teenage girls charged with southside assaults

A 13-year-old girl was allegedly assaulted by two teenage girls as she got off a bus in Erindale early on Friday afternoon.

Police say the 13-year old suffered significant injuries from this assault, including having her braces dislodged.

Then, about 3.20pm on Saturday police responded to reports of several more incidents within the Tuggeranong Town Centre allegedly involving the same two teenage girls as well as other juveniles.

These include the alleged assault of an elderly man and staff in Big W, and the alleged assault of another 13-year-old girl at the Tuggeranong bus interchange, who also suffered significant injuries, including spinal fractures.

The two girls were arrested nearby a short time later  and have been charged with joint commission assault occasioning actual bodily harm.

There may have been other incidents involving this group around the same time and police are looking for any victims and witnesses.
